Select 4G LTE instead of 5G. 5G drains the battery much faster unless you're on 5G SA (stand-alone) because 5G NSA (which most carriers use) doesn't support calling and texting, so 5G and LTE must be used simultaneously. Using two networks at the same time is a major battery drainer.

With this Use 5G option for calls, I can receive calls and the network doesn't drop to 4G.
But that doesn't mean that you're using 5G SA or calling over 5G unless it is actually available on your carrier at that moment. As you can see in the screenshots below, I have 5G selected as the Preferred Network Type and Vo5G enabled, but I'm connected to LTE, not 5G SA. And the Voice Network Type is LTE
